Is It Hard to Get Into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ati?

Open Admissions Policy

Acceptance Rate

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ati has an open admissions policy, so you should not have much trouble being accepted by the school. Still, it is important to fill out the application completely and submit any requested materials, which may include proof that you have a high school diploma or the equivalent.

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ati Faculty

13 to 1 Student to Faculty
67% Full Time Teachers

Student to Faculty Ratio

The student to faculty ratio is often used to estimate how much interaction there is between professors and their students at a college or university. At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ati, this ratio is 13 to 1, which is on par with the national average of 15 to 1. That's not bad at all.

Percent of Full-Time Faculty

When estimating how much access students will have to their teachers, some people like to look at what percentage of faculty members are full time. This is because part-time teachers may not have as much time to spend on campus as their full-time counterparts.

The full-time faculty percentage at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ati is 67%. This is higher than the national average of 47%.

Retention and Graduation Rates at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ati

80% Freshmen Retention

Freshmen Retention Rate

The freshmen retention rate of 80% tells us that most first-year, full-time students like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ati enough to come back for another year. This is a fair bit higher than the national average of 68%. That's certainly something to check off in the good column about the school.

How Much Does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ati Cost?

$28,831 Net Price
87% Take Out Loans
$27,992 Total Student Loans
The overall average net price of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ati is $28,831.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group. See the table below for the net price for different income groups.

Net Price by Income Group for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ati

$0-30 K$30K-48K$48-75$75-110K$110K +
$28,350$29,033$30,301$31,563$32,059

The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id.Note that the net price is typically less than the published for a school. Student Loan Debt

While almost two-thirds of students nationwide take out loans to pay for college, the percentage may be quite different for the school you plan on attending. At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ati, approximately 87% of students took out student loans averaging $6,998 a year. That adds up to $27,992 over four years for those students.

How Much Money Do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ati Graduates Make?

$61,480 Avg Salary of Grads
High Earnings Boost
The pay for some majors is higher than others, but on average, students who graduate with a bachelor's degree from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ati make about $61,480 a year during their first few years of employment after graduation. This is good news for future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ati graduates since it is 25% more than the average college graduate's salary of $49,219 per year.

Online Learning at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ati

100% Take At Least One Class Online

Online courses area a great option for busy, working students as well as for those who have scheduling conflicts and want to study on their own time. As time goes by, expect to see more and more online learning options become available.

In 2022-2023, 692 students took at least one online class at Galen College of Nursing - Cincinnati. This is a decrease from the 952 students who took online classes the previous year.

YearTook at Least One Online ClassTook All Classes Online
2022-20236920
2021-20229520
2020-20217480
2018-20193780
